The Origins of the Surname Bryczkowski

The surname Bryczkowski is of Polish origin and is derived from the personal name Bryczko, which itself is a diminutive form of the old Polish given name Bryczyslaw. The suffix "-owski" is a common suffix in Polish surnames, indicating a place of origin or association. Therefore, Bryczkowski likely originally referred to someone from a place associated with Bryczko or Bryczyslaw.

Early History and Distribution

According to data, the surname Bryczkowski is most commonly found in Poland, with a significant incidence rate of 435. This suggests that the surname has deep roots in Polish history and is still prevalent among the population.

Poland

In Poland, the surname Bryczkowski is most commonly found in regions such as Warsaw, Krakow, and Gdansk. It has been passed down through generations and has become a significant part of Polish identity for those who bear the name.
